A member asked:

Is it ok to have hematuria for over 7 months?

No.: Usually it is not a good sign to have blood anywhere. Although blood in the urine can be related to a benign condition such as polyps or prostatitis or chronic cystitis. Need further evaluation.

Here are some ...: For someone at 50, hematuria alone should incite personal concern and professional urge to initiate a comprehensive evaluation; don't wait but go to see urologist now. As to being okay or not for 7 months, that depends the degree and duration of bloody urine.
